Handover for the weekly eng sync: I'm transferring ownership of Duskrunner, our nightly backfill scheduler, to Priya. Current state: all jobs healthy except the ledger-reconciliation backfill, which retries once nightly due to a slow upstream from the Kestwick warehouse. Retry logic, window sizing, and concurrency caps were all tuned carefully last quarter — please don't change them without a load test. For full transparency at the sync, the production instance runs with these configuration values.

settings of hawep-kadug:
RALAEL_HOST=ralael.tolvaqlabs.internal
RALAEL_PORT=9000

Ticket QMX-4471: Expired credentials blocking log compaction hooks. Plugin authors integrating with the Corvet message queue should note that the compaction-callback endpoint rejected requests starting Tuesday because the shared service credential lapsed. Compaction itself completed, but external hooks received 401 responses. A replacement credential has been issued with a twelve-month validity window. Update your plugin configuration to use the key below.

gateway credential: kto3_qfe

When the audit-log viewer in Ledgerpane shows gaps, first check the ingest cursor — it stalls if a partition compaction ran during export. Restart the ingest worker, then backfill from the last committed offset; do not replay from zero, as that duplicates entries. Verify row counts against the warehouse before closing the ticket. Record the backfill against the build noted below.

pipeline stamp: htk31_f769b577b3028a4e9958e5bb8d1259a

# Markdown Pipeline: Limits

The Inkfall renderer enforces per-document limits. Oversized input is rejected, not truncated. Nested structures beyond the depth cap render as plain text. Embedded assets count against a separate quota. Limits apply per request, not per tenant. Don't raise them without sign-off from the Brindlemoor platform team. Current values live in config, shown below.

tuning table, yajog-yahof:
BUDGETS = {
    "lamvan": 303,
    "wenox": 460,
    "fenvan": 525,
}